What Lens to Take on Safari?

The old adage of “The best camera to have is the one you have with you” will always stand true on safari, and the same can be said for lenses.
Most scenes and/or sightings can be reimagined to make your lens work for you, from an 8mm fish-eye to an 800mm zoom.

Ok that might be stretching it a little, as a proper wide-angle won’t get you that nice close up of a bird from forty metres away, nor will you be able to encompass a whole pride of lions next to your vehicle in one photo with a mega-zoom, but if you do happen to find yourself seemingly limited by your lens choice, simply zoom out (figuratively), and start to imagine what’s in front of you in a new way.

The solution of course is simply to have a selection of lenses with you, and move between them as the situation dictates, but multiple lenses can start getting expensive and heavy, not to mention dust-filled if you are constantly switching them out. Multiple camera bodies take care of this latter problem, but again you start encountering extra weight and expense.

What we want to do here is give a brief run through of some of the most commonly used lenses on safari, what they’re good for, and which parts of Africa you should be sure to pack them for.

WIDE ANGLE

These lenses are essentially wider than 35mm. They can be fixed or zoom lenses. The 16-35mm range is a popular one.
Wide-angle are severely underrated in the safari world. The tendency for most safari-goers is to want to zoom in close. This can be great if you’re after detail, or trying to isolate a single subject, but just because you can zoom, doesn’t mean you should. More often than not, by zooming in too much you are excluding critical elements of the photographic story. Wide angle lenses allow you to capture an entire scene, not just one single element of it.
Landscapes, big herds of elephants, room interiors… these are a few things you might want a wide-angle for. Astrophotography is pretty much impossible without a wide-angle, and they can be very effective in exaggerating the scale of something (see the elephant photo below).

Wider is often better, and since these lenses are quite compact more often than not, they won’t take up too much room in your camera bag.

Best Destinations for Wide-Angle: Namibia, Cape Town

MEDIUM ZOOM

Between 50mm and 300mm is generally your sweet spot if yu want a lens to tick as many boxes as possible. Wide enough to capture a landscape is an animal is far enough away from you, but with enough zoom to really be able to isolate a subject if its proximity allows for it. The 70-200mm f2.8 lens is the mainstay of wildlife photographers around the world, and Canon, Nikon and Sony all make one.

The f2.8 aperture is wide enough to be able to carry on shooting in low light conditions (eg. dawn and dusk), and in areas where the wildlife is habituated to vehicles and can therefore come quite close, any more zoom just feels excessive.

Best Destinations for Medium Zoom: Sabi Sands, Lower Zambezi, Gorilla Trekking

FIXED TELEPHOTO

Starting from 300mm, things start to get interesting. Your zoom is starting to pack a real punch, and fixed zoom lenses generally allow for wider apertures, which ultimately means better low-light performance, higher shutter speeds and fewer missed shots. The 400mm f2.8 in particular is an incredible lens.
The image quality tends to be superb, but since the focal length is fixed, you can sometimes feel a bit constrained. This is when a bit of creativity can be necessary.

With 500mm, 600mm and 800mm you are dealing with seriously bulky lenses, They can take amazing photos – portraits of a lions face from a good distance, crisp shots of tiny birds that make them look larger than life – but the lack of mobility can be a hindrance. Some sort of support in the form of a bean bag or Wimberley arm is needed when shooting from a vehicle, or a tripod if you are on foot.

Best Destinations for Fixed Telephoto: Serengeti, Maasai Mara, any bird-focused photography trip.

There is no right or wrong in your lens selection.
Certain lenses might be the only way to capture specific images, but sightings need not be restricted to those specific images; it’s ultimately up to your imagination how you choose to represent a sighting.

Low Light Photography

This is probably one of the trickiest areas of wildlife photography to get right.
Photography is all about light, and the less there is, the harder it is to take a sharp photograph. After sunset or before sunrise, cloudy days, or even shooting with a spotlight; all present their challenges, some of which can be overcome and others not so much. But with a couple of trips and tricks, you should be able to get some very memorable photos even when conditions are poor.

1. Know Your Equipment

A good workman never blames his tools, so they say, but the simple reality here is that some camera equipment is significantly better than others. Certain lenses let in more light, some bodies can cope with almost complete darkness, and having this more advanced (but unfortunately more expensive) equipment will go a long way towards getting better photos when the light is poor.
The two things to look for are lens that has a wide aperture (f2.8 or below) and a camera body with high ISO capability (ISO is a measure of the camera’s sensitivity to light). If you have those two you can probably keep snapping away for awhile when the sun has gone down.

If on the other hand you don’t have the advanced gear that the serious amateurs or professional photographers will make use of, it is important to recognise when you are barking up the wrong tree. You will probably hear a very slow shutter speed coming into play (your ranger will identify it for you), resulting in blurry photos.

Simply put your camera down, forget about taking photos, and enjoy watching whatever’s in front of you.

2. Try Something Different

Low light can be an excellent time to experiment.
If a leopard isn’t bathed in golden light but is instead moving slowly along  on a cold grey morning, it’s time to think outside the box.
Your camera will detect that there isn’t enough light around and use a slow shutter speed to compensate, but you can use this to your advantage.

By panning along with your subject, be it elephant, lion or leopard, and using a slow shutter speed, the background should blur out a bit whilst the animal (hopefully) stays sharp. This panning effect implies motion, and is a very effective way of conveying story, which is ultimately what wildlife photography is all about.

Understand Metering and Exposure

You are smarter than your camera. At least hopefully. Whilst you can clearly see that the world in front of you is veiled in darkness and the leopard illuminated in the spotlight is the only thing to concentrate on, and clearly the subject of your desired photo, your camera doesn’t know better. It will just see the darkness and try to compensate for it. It will open the shutter for longer to let more light in, thus massively overexposing the leopard and probably blurring it as well.

In a case like this, you need to tell the camera to keep things dark. You do this by adjusting the exposure. Have a read of a previous post of ours here to understand the concept a bit better.

Knowing how your camera reacts to different levels of light is crucial. The more advanced your photography becomes, the more control you will likely take away from it and put into your own hands (ie. you will be deciding all the settings for yourself).

 

Know What Your Subject Is

Is it the scene or is it the animal?

Do you want to accentuate the clouds or do you want detail in the wildlife?

A lot of the time in wildlife photography, you have to compromise. Make sacrifices. It’s like a relationship. Know what you have to give up on one side to gain something on the other.
Take a look at the photograph below, of wildebeest in the Maasai Mara.
Had the shot been exposed for the wildebeest, the dramatic colours in the evening sky would have been lost (the shutter would have necessarily been slower). Instead, the sky’s colours were prioritised and the wildebeest and lone tree were left as mere silhouettes. Which in turn tells its own story.
It would be very difficult (without the use of a flash or spotlight) to capture detail in both the sky and the wildebeest.

Ultimately, understanding exactly what shot you’re after, what settings you need to capture it, and what the limits of your equipment actually are, all combine to define how you can photograph in low light. But it’s certainly not a case of putting your camera away when the light fades.
Quite the contrary.

Photography Tips: Understanding Exposure

Exposure is simply a matter of how dark or light a photograph is.
Too dark is termed underexposed, too light and it’s referred to as overexposed. Just right and it’s called even or neutral exposure.

Left to right: Underexposed, correct exposure, overexposed.

In its simplest form, exposure is a function of three factors: shutter speed, aperture and ISO. We’ll go into these in more detail in a future post, but for now just know the following: 

Shutter speed is how long light is able to enter the camera for.

Aperture is the size of the opening through which light enters the camera; the wider the opening the more light that can come in.

ISO is the camera’s sensitivity to that light. Making it more sensitive without changing either of the other two factors will result in lighter image.

Leaving out ISO for the moment, let’s just look at the combination of shutter speed and aperture.

The way I lie to think of it is to imagine I’m trying to fill a bucket with water. The tap I’m pouring the water out of is how I control the water. The wider the diameter of the hole the water is coming out of (Aperture) the more water can come out in a set period of time, and the longer that set period of time is (shutter speed), the more water will come out as well.

Fast shutter speeds are used to freeze action; very helpful for wildlife photography in which animals are often moving fast.

The next step is to set a specific amount of water I want (exposure). Let’s say we set that level to the middle of the bucket, and we’ll call this even exposure.
If I have a very narrow apertured tap, only a thin stream will emerge, and I will need to run the tap for longer to get the level to the middle, ie. I will need a slower shutter speed.

If, however, the tap’s aperture is very wide, I will literally only need to open and close the tap and a large volume of water will come out, thus reaching the desired level in a much shorter time, ie. a faster shutter speed.

A faster shutter speed is used to underexpose the photo in silhouette photography, resulting in the colours of the sunset popping out more.

I hope this is making sense so far.

If you’re following, it should be becoming evident that the same exposure level (water in the bucket) can be achieved in different ways; a slow shutter speed and narrower aperture or a fast shutter speed and wider aperture. Many combinations of the two will give the same end result.

In photography however, photographs are going to look very different depending on which option you select to achieve your desired exposure level.
A faster shutter speed will freeze the action, while a slower one will result in motion blur. Both are great, so long as you understand which is going to do what.
Most of the time in wildlife photography you are wanting to freeze action, so the wider aperture/faster shutter speed combination is best.

A slower shutter speed can result in motion blur, which can be useful in creative photography, but it’s not always what you want.

Lenses have a limit to just how wide their apertures can open though, which brings us to the third and final part of what is known as the Exposure Triangle: ISO.

ISO is a measure of your camera’s sensitivity to light. More sensitive means it can achieve higher shutter speeds. The trade-off is that the image quality will degrade slightly as the ISO is increased, but this is a price you have to pay to achieve fast enough shutter speeds to not have a blurry image.

“Trade-off” is the key thing to remember here, as the Exposure triangle – comprised of shutter speed, aperture and ISO – is a constant compromise between the three, in which one or the other is generally prioritised to achieve the desired result.
